The Western Region has recorded a total of one thousand three hundred and fifty-eight (1,358) COVID-19 patients having recovered and discharged from the various isolation centers across the region.
The region has since the outbreak recorded one thousand, four hundred and twenty-nine (1,429) cases of COVID-19, and unfortunately three patients have lost their lives to the virus. This brings to total sixty-eight (68) active cases in the Western Region.
The Regional Health Directorate in their published surveillance report, noted that the region despite being considered a hot spot have managed to control the pandemic to a greater extent.
An enhanced routine surveillance had been in place to quickly identify, isolate and manage any suspected or confirmed cases. All the thirteen (13) districts in the Western Region have prepared an isolation center where these patients are being managed.
To date, the Sekondi Takoradi Metropolis tops the chart with a total of 535 confirmed cases, followed by the Tarkwa Nsuaem Municipal with 445 cases.
All other districts, except the Amenfi Central have recorded cases of the novel coronavirus.
